Mesobilirubin IX
| ![]() |
Lightner, D.A.; Park, Y.-T.
Experientia 34, 555-557 (1978)
Reaction: Mesobilirubin IX + 1O2* ®
products and/or physical quenching
Solvent: CHCl3
k = 2.8 × 109(L mol-1 s-1)
Experimental method: Photolysis
Analytical method: vis-UV absorption
Data type: Derived from steady state measurements
Excitation wavelength: 560 nm
Photosensitizer = Rose Bengal complexed with dicyclohexyl-18-crown-8; used solvent kd = 1.7 × 104 s-1; kprod. = 5.9 × 108 L/(mol·s) derived using sensitizer quantum yield.
[Indicator] = 1 × 10-5 (mol L-1).
Lightner, D.A.; Park, Y.-T.
Experientia 34, 555-557 (1978)
Reaction: Mesobilirubin IX + 1O2* ®
products and/or physical quenching
Solvent: MeOH
k = 2.5 × 109(L mol-1 s-1)
Experimental method: Photolysis
Analytical method: vis-UV absorption
Data type: Derived from steady state measurements
Excitation wavelength: 557 nm
Photosensitizer = Rose Bengal dianion; used solvent kd = 1.4 × 105 s-1; soln. contg. 2% NH4OH; kprod. = 7.9 × 108 L/(mol·s) derived using sensitizer quantum yield.
[Indicator] = 1 × 10-5 (mol L-1).
